LaTeX は、学術や研究で広く使用されている文書作成システムです。高品質の数式を作成できることで知られています。 LaTeX は、特に初心者にとって、学習と使用が難しい場合があります。このブログ投稿では、LaTeX を学習しなくても数式を作成できるオンライン LaTeX 数式ジェネレーターを紹介します。記号を使用して方程式を入力し、LaTeX コードを生成できます。
LaTeX 数式ジェネレーター - LaTeX 数式を PNG に変換
この無料のオンライン LaTeX Formula Generator アプリを使用すると、LaTeX 数式を作成してレンダリングできます。追加のソフトウェアをインストールしたり、何かを購読したりすることなく、任意のデバイスと場所からアクセスできます。
ブラウザでこの無料の数式生成アプリにアクセスして、オンラインで LaTeX 数学を作成し、結果を PNG として保存します。
LaTeX 数式ジェネレーター - LaTeX 数式を SVG に変換
同様に、この無料のオンライン LaTeX Math Equation Generator アプリを使用して、LaTeX 数式を作成およびレンダリングし、結果を SVG として保存することもできます。
LaTeX 数式ジェネレーターをオンラインで使用する
- LaTeX 数式を入力するか、数式カテゴリを選択してから、数式テンプレートを選択します。
- 必要に応じて、背景色、スケール、解像度を選択します。
- 「表示」ボタンをクリックして、生成された式を表示します。
- 画像をダウンロードして保存します。
このツールには、必要なすべての式カテゴリと、それぞれを簡単に操作できるテンプレートが含まれています。
さらに、方程式のスケールと解像度を変更したり、レンダリング オプションを使用して背景色を追加して独自のスタイルを作成したりできます。
LaTeX 数式ジェネレーター - 開発者ガイド
この無料のオンライン アプリは、Aspose.TeX ライブラリ を使用して構築されました。あなたが開発者で、LaTeX 数式生成アプリケーションを作成したい場合は、.NET、Java、および C++ で利用可能なネイティブ API バリアントを使用して作成できます。
C# の LaTeX 数式ジェネレーター
以下の手順に従って、C# でプログラム的に数式や方程式を生成できます。
- Aspose.Tex for .NET をアプリケーションにインストールします。
- 次のコード スニペットを使用して、数式を画像としてレンダリングします。
// このコード例は、数式と方程式をレンダリングする方法を示しています。
// 画像解像度 150 dpi を指定してレンダリング オプションを作成する
MathRendererOptions options = new PngMathRendererOptions() { Resolution = 150 };
// プリアンブルを指定します。
options.Preamble = @"\usepackage{amsmath}
\usepackage{amsfonts}
\usepackage{amssymb}
\usepackage{color}";
// 倍率300%を指定します。
options.Scale = 3000;
// 前景色を指定します。
options.TextColor = System.Drawing.Color.Black;
// 背景色を指定します。
options.BackgroundColor = System.Drawing.Color.White;
// ログファイルの出力ストリームを指定します。
options.LogStream = new MemoryStream();
// ターミナル出力をコンソールに表示するかどうかを指定します。
options.ShowTerminal = true;
// 結果の画像の寸法が書き込まれる変数。
System.Drawing.SizeF size = new System.Drawing.SizeF();
// 数式イメージの出力ストリームを作成します。
using (Stream stream = File.Open(@"D:\Files\Tex\math-formula.png", FileMode.Create))
// レンダリングを実行します。
MathRenderer.Render(@"This is a sample formula $f(x) = x^2$ example.", stream, options, out size);
// 他の結果を表示します。
System.Console.Out.WriteLine(options.ErrorReport);
System.Console.Out.WriteLine();
System.Console.Out.WriteLine("Size: " + size);
LaTeX 方程式と数式を C# でレンダリングする 方法に関する完全なステップバイステップ ガイドをお読みください。また、LaTeX 数式を C# で SVG にレンダリングする方法を学ぶこともできます。
Java の LaTeX 数式ジェネレーター
同様に、以下の手順に従って、Java でプログラム的に数式や方程式を生成できます。
- Aspose.Tex for Java をアプリケーションにインストールします。
- 次のコード スニペットを使用して、数式を画像としてレンダリングします。
// このコード例は、数式と方程式を PNG としてレンダリングする方法を示しています。
// PNG レンダリング オプションを作成する
PngMathRendererOptions options = new PngMathRendererOptions();
// 画像解像度150dpiを指定します
options.setResolution(150);
// プリアンブルを指定します。
options.setPreamble("\\usepackage{amsmath}\n"
+ "\\usepackage{amsfonts}\n"
+ "\\usepackage{amssymb}\n"
+ "\\usepackage{color}");
// 倍率300%を指定します。
options.setScale(3000);
// 前景色を指定します。
options.setTextColor(Color.BLACK);
// 背景色を指定します。
options.setBackgroundColor(Color.WHITE);
// ログファイルの出力ストリームを指定します。
options.setLogStream(new ByteArrayOutputStream());
// ターミナル出力をコンソールに表示するかどうかを指定します。
options.showTerminal(true);
// 結果の画像の寸法が書き込まれる変数。
com.aspose.tex.Size2D size = new com.aspose.tex.Size2D.Float();
// 数式イメージの出力ストリームを作成します。
final OutputStream stream = new FileOutputStream("D:\\Files\\Tex\\simple-formula.png");
// PNG としてレンダリング
PngMathRenderer mathRenderer = new PngMathRenderer();
mathRenderer.render("This is a sample formula $f(x) = x^2$ example.", stream, options, size);
// 他の結果を表示します。
System.out.println(options.getErrorReport());
System.out.println();
System.out.println("Size: " + size.getWidth() + "x" + size.getHeight());
Java での LaTeX 数式と方程式 のレンダリングに関する完全なチュートリアルをお読みください。
無料ライセンスを取得する
無料の一時ライセンスを取得して、評価制限なしでライブラリを試すことができます。
LaTeX 方程式ジェネレーター – 学習リソース
以下のリソースを使用して、TEX ファイルの表示、変換、マージの詳細を学習し、ライブラリのその他の機能を探索できます。
結論
結論として、無料のオンライン LaTeX 数式ジェネレーター ツールを調査しました。このツールは、LaTeX を学習せずに数式を作成するための優れた方法です。使いやすく、正確で、持ち運び可能で、無料で利用できます。文書に数式が必要な場合は、このオンライン LaTeX 数式ジェネレーターが最適です。また、C# と Java の両方を使用して数式と方程式をレンダリングする方法についても説明しました。今すぐこのオンライン数式エディター ツールの使用を開始するか、ニーズを満たす独自のカスタマイズされたソリューションを開発してください。不明な点がある場合は、無料サポート フォーラムまでお気軽にお問い合わせください。